Stop the Restriction of Antiandronic Medications for Child Sex Abusers

Additional Information

This petition is to challenge the availability of antiandronic medications for child sex abusers. Pharmaceutical treatments are currently used on a voluntary basis for convicted sexual offenders. However, if an individual approaches their GP with concerns that they, themselves, are going to sexually abuse a child they are not permitted to undergo the medical treatments. I would like the government to change this so medications used to treat sex offenders is available to non-offenders on a voluntary basis. This prevents an individual standing up in court, using the excuse, "I abused that child to receive medical treatments."
